The Evolution of Aircraft Maintenance Software

Aircraft maintenance software has traditionally straddled a delicate balance: ensuring regulatory compliance while streamlining workflows. Over the last decade, systems have shifted from static record-keeping to dynamic, data-driven platforms. Understanding the Core Innovations in Aviamasters 2

The new features introduced by Aviamasters 2 are not merely incremental improvements—they signal a strategic leap towards predictive maintenance, real-time analytics, and enhanced user experience. Here’s a detailed breakdown of the key innovations:

FeatureDescriptionIndustry Impact
AI-Driven Predictive MaintenanceUtilizes machine learning algorithms to forecast component failures before they occur.Reduces unexpected downtime, enhances safety, and optimizes inventory management.
Real-Time Data IntegrationConnects with aircraft avionics to provide live diagnostics during flights and ground runs.Enables proactive interventions, minimizing delays and costly repairs.
Intuitive User InterfaceRedesigned dashboards with customizable views and streamlined navigation.Facilitates faster decision-making and reduces training time for technicians.
Enhanced Regulatory Compliance ToolsAutomates documentation and reporting aligned with FAA/EASA standards.Ensures audits are smoother and reduces the risk of compliance breaches.

Industry Insights: The Strategic Significance of These Features

By integrating AI-powered analytics with real-time data streams, Aviamasters 2 enables aviation maintenance to shift from reactive to predictive paradigms. For instance, airlines adopting predictive maintenance report up to 30% reductions in unscheduled repairs, translating into significant cost savings and improved on-time performance.

Furthermore, the intuitive interface democratizes complex data, empowering technicians and engineers with accessible insights. This democratization is critical for scaling maintenance operations across diverse fleets, especially under high operational tempo.
